ENTITY’S PURPOSE & MISSION: The Centre for Fine Woodworking was founded in 2006 to facilitate the highest quality of educational opportunities for woodworkers from New Zealand as well as around the world. Our aims and objectives are:- • To offer our students a learning environment and commitment to achieving the highest standards of fine woodworking; • To establish a network of international connections to encourage interactions between woodworkers from around the world. • The vision then and now was to create a "School of Excellence" which rather than be linked to a formal qualification or education offers experiential and self-directed learning to anyone who has a passion to take their woodworking and fine furniture making skills to the highest level. • Our ten year goal is to be and be known to be the best centre in Australasia for learning fine woodworking and associated craft.
